At stake in this election:
- The office of President of Russia
Description of government structure:
- Chief of State: President Vladimir Vladimirovich PUTIN
- Head of Government: Premier Viktor Alekseyevich ZUBKOV
- Assembly: Russia has a bicameral Federal Assembly (Federalnoye Sobraniye) consisting of the Federation Council (Sovet Federatsii) with 168 seats and the State Duma (Gosudarstvennaya Duma) with 450 seats.
Description of electoral system:
- The President is elected by popular vote to serve a 4-year term.
- Premier is appointed by the president.
- In the Federation Council (Sovet Federatsii)
168 members are
appointed
to serve 4-year terms*. In the State Duma (Gosudarstvennaya Duma)
450 members are
elected
by direct popular vote to serve 4-year terms.**
